The Issue: Engine Oil Leak in a Mercedes C200
When a vehicle experiences an engine oil leak, it is not only an inconvenience, but it can also lead to more severe problems if left untreated. The Mercedes C200 brought into Meta Mechanics for repairs had been experiencing noticeable oil spots on the ground, indicating a potential leak in the engine.
Upon a thorough inspection, our experts found that the engine oil leak was originating from several areas of the engine, including the oil filter housing and valve cover gasket. These components are critical to ensuring the engine operates smoothly and without oil loss. The leak was causing the engine oil levels to drop, which in turn posed a risk of engine overheating and further damage to the internal components.
Common Causes of Engine Oil Leaks
At Meta Mechanics, we have come across a variety of causes for engine oil leaks. Here are some common reasons:
1. Worn or Damaged Gaskets
Gaskets like the valve cover gasket or oil filter housing gasket can wear out over time. These gaskets form seals around key engine components, and when they break down, they can lead to oil leaks.
2. Loose or Damaged Oil Pan
If the oil pan becomes loose or develops a crack, it can result in a slow oil leak. This can be due to wear and tear, incorrect installation, or external damage.
3. Cracked Engine Block or Cylinder Head
In rare cases, a crack in the engine block or cylinder head can lead to a significant oil leak, which can be difficult and expensive to repair.
4. Faulty Oil Filter
A poorly installed or defective oil filter can lead to oil leaks. It’s essential to ensure that the oil filter is correctly installed and replaced regularly.
5. Oil Pressure Sensor Leaks
The oil pressure sensor, which monitors the oil pressure in the engine, can also be a source of leaks. If the seal around the sensor is compromised, it can cause oil to leak out.
The Meta Mechanics Solution: Engine Oil Leak Repair
After identifying the source of the engine oil leak in the Mercedes C200, our team of experts began the repair process. Here’s what we did:
1. Thorough Inspection and Diagnostics
The first step was a detailed inspection to pinpoint the exact location of the leak. Using advanced diagnostic tools, we identified the faulty gaskets and oil filter as the primary culprits.
2. Replacing Faulty Components
We replaced the worn-out valve cover gasket and the oil filter housing gasket. These components are responsible for maintaining the integrity of the oil system in the engine. After replacing the defective parts, we ensured that they were properly sealed to prevent future leaks.
3. Engine Cleaning and Oil Refill
Once the necessary parts were replaced, we thoroughly cleaned the engine to remove any oil residue. We then refilled the engine with high-quality engine oil, ensuring that the correct amount was added for optimal engine performance.
4. Leak Test and Final Inspection
After the repairs, we conducted a leak test to confirm that the issue was fully resolved. We also did a final inspection to ensure that there were no other underlying problems that could lead to further issues.

Mercedes C200 Oil Leak Diagnosis
The first step involves inspecting the vehicle to determine the source and severity of the oil leak, using advanced diagnostic tools and techniques.
Mercedes C200 Engine Oil Seal Replacement
Worn-out or damaged engine oil seals are replaced to prevent leaks. This process requires removing components like the timing belt or valve covers for access.
Mercedes C200 Gasket Replacement
Engine gaskets, especially the valve cover gasket, are crucial in preventing leaks. Replacing faulty gaskets restores the engine’s integrity and keeps oil contained.
Mercedes C200 Oil Pan Repair or Replacement
The oil pan can develop cracks or leaks over time. Repairing or replacing the oil pan ensures the engine remains well-lubricated and free of leaks.
Mercedes C200 Valve Cover Seal Replacement
The valve cover seals can deteriorate with age, leading to leaks. Replacing them ensures proper oil containment and prevents potential engine damage.
Mercedes C200 Timing Cover Gasket Replacement
The timing cover gasket prevents oil from leaking from the timing cover area. Replacing it helps to keep the engine sealed and avoids oil loss.
Mercedes C200 Oil Filter Housing Repair
The oil filter housing can sometimes develop cracks or improper sealing. Repairing or replacing this component ensures that oil flow remains uninterrupted and leaks are avoided.
Mercedes C200 Oil Cooler Line Replacement
Leaking oil cooler lines can cause oil to spill onto the engine. Replacing the lines prevents such leaks and ensures the engine’s cooling system works properly.
Mercedes C200 Front and Rear Main Seal Replacement
The front and rear main seals are critical for preventing oil from leaking from the engine. Replacement of these seals helps in maintaining the engine’s performance and avoiding oil loss.
Mercedes C200 Pressure Testing of Oil System
After repairing oil leaks, a pressure test is conducted to ensure there are no further leaks and the engine’s oil system is functioning optimally.
